The guidelines you're most likely to see in a quality teacher resume sample

are as follows:

The most important information at the top of the page.
First phrases of any section should include expressive verbs to illustrate skills.
Remaining phrases should compliment first phrases and descriptions.
Precise information for describing responsibilities and accomplishments.
Removal of any and all spelling and grammar mistakes and typos.
